International Conference on Corporate Governance in Emerging Markets, Istanbul

The International Conference on Corporate Governance in Emerging Markets was held in Istanbul on November 15 – 17, 2007. At the conference, the Forum, in collaboration with the Asian Institute of Corporate Governance (AICG), presented research works investigating the impact of corporate governance in emerging markets’ firms performance and the roles of legal, economic, and political institutions in determining corporate governance systems. The three-day research conference had the objective of supporting policy and practice development, and providing an opportunity to relate academic research findings to practice in emerging markets.
